Same product, different SKUs on platforms – your books treat them as two products.
Product-level P&L is impossible when one item splits into three rows in your books.
A 500-SKU catalog means 500 manual entries, and every product launch restarts the cycle.
When products don't reconcile across channels, the numbers built on them – COGS, quantity, product P&L – stop being trustworthy.
Synder consolidates SKUs from every sales channel into one accounting item per product, so your catalog stays clean as you scale.

Yes. Multiple platform SKUs can map to a single accounting item. The reverse isn't supported, but bundles can expand one platform product into multiple items at sync.
That’s supported. Map "Red Apple" and "Green Apple" from your sales platform to a single "Apple" item in your books. Product Mapping is set up separately for each connected sales channel.
Both. Map products individually in the app, or upload a two-column CSV to map your full catalog at once. You can also export your current mapping to CSV.
Mappings apply to syncs going forward. Past transactions stay where they were posted. And if you want the history corrected, re-sync the affected period after updating mappings, or contact Synder support for help with bulk corrections.
Yes, product mapping is supported in both. Per Transaction maps each transaction line to its accounting item. In Summary Sync, group summaries by individual SKU or by product category.
